v.2.0.0:
- change in seed servers.
- fixed compile errors in debian 9/ubuntu 17

v.1.5.0. (EDA):
- added Emergency Difficulty Adjustement (EDA)
  If producing the last 6 block took more than 12h, increase the difficulty
  target by 1/4 (which reduces the difficulty by 20%). This ensure the
  chain do not get stuck in case we lose hashrate abruptly.
- added Stalled Network Recovery (SNR)
  If the new block's timestamp is more than 72h
  then allow mining of a min-difficulty block.

There are several different types of Bitcoin clients. The most secure are full nodes like Bitcoin Core, which will follow the rules of the network no matter what miners do. Even if every miner decided to create 1000 bitcoins per block, full nodes would stick to the rules and reject those blocks.
